Vulnerability Details : CVE-2009-3711
Public exploit exists!
Stack-based buffer overflow in the h_handlepeer function in http.cpp in httpdx 1.4, and possibly 1.4.3,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a long HTTP GET request.
Vulnerability category: OverflowExecute codeDenial of service

Metasploit modules for CVE-2009-3711
-
HTTPDX h_handlepeer() Function Buffer Overflow
Disclosure Date: 2009-10-08First seen: 2020-04-26exploit/windows/http/httpdx_handlepeerThis module exploits a st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ability in HTTPDX HTTP server 1.4.
